J.M. Forrest, 95, of Hagerstown, passed away peacefully on Monday, April 16, 2018, at The Springs of Richmond.
He was born near Hagerstown on July 5, 1922 to Claude Leon and Opal May (Laudig) Forrest and was a life long resident of the Hagerstown area. On December 24, 1946 he married Georgia Elinor Timmons and she preceded him in death in 1997.
J was a graduate of Hagerstown High School, attended Butler University and was a member of Congregational Christian Church, UCC. He served with the Marine Corps. He was a life long farmer and former used car dealer.
